Milan to Umbrian Hill Towns

After a roughly three-hour drive, your first stop is Orvieto. Known for its striking Cathedral (Duomo), which boasts a breathtaking façade, and St. Patrick’s Well, a marvel of medieval engineering, this town offers a glimpse into Italy’s architectural and cultural richness. The tickets for St. Patrick’s Well are included, giving you an opportunity to marvel at the spiral staircase that descends into the underground water reservoir—an engineering feat that’s both practical and visually impressive.

What sets Orvieto apart is its clifftop position, providing sweeping views of the surrounding countryside. We love that you can explore at your own pace—take your time wandering the narrow streets, soaking in the atmosphere, or visiting local artisan shops. The highlight is the Duomo, with its intricate façade and stunning interior.

Next, you’ll visit a family-run winery nearby for a wine-tasting lunch. This is a real treat, as the setting offers spectacular views of the vineyards, and the wines are local and high quality. The relaxed, intimate atmosphere adds a layer of authenticity many travelers miss. The tasting complements the morning’s sightseeing, giving you a taste of Italy’s celebrated wine culture.

After lunch, your trip continues to Narni, an ancient town that served as the inspiration for C.S. Lewis’ Narnia. Here, you’ll explore the Narni Underground, which includes underground chambers and tunnels that have been carved out over centuries. It’s a fantastic way to connect with the town’s medieval roots and the stories that swirl around its hidden depths.
